
在众多操作系统中,Linux凭借其开源、稳定、高效及强大的定制能力,在路由器领域独树一帜,尤其是“Linux空路由”概念的出现,更是为网络架构师和安全专家提供了一种全新的、高度可配置的路由解决方案
本文将深入探讨Linux空路由的优势、构建方法、应用场景以及安全策略,旨在展示其作为现代网络中枢的强大潜力
一、Linux空路由概述 Linux空路由,顾名思义,是指基于Linux操作系统搭建的、不预装任何特定网络服务的路由器
与传统商业路由器相比,Linux空路由的最大特点在于其高度的灵活性和可定制性
用户可以根据实际需求,自由选择并安装所需的网络协议、防火墙规则、流量监控工具等,从而构建一个完全符合自身需求的网络环境
Linux空路由的核心优势在于: 1.开源与免费:Linux作为开源操作系统,其源代码公开透明,用户可以免费获取并自由修改,降低了硬件和软件成本
2.稳定性与安全性:得益于Linux系统的成熟与广泛应用,其稳定性和安全性得到了广泛认可,能够有效抵御各种网络攻击
3.高性能:Linux内核经过优化,能够高效处理大量并发连接,适合高负载网络环境
4.强大的社区支持:Linux拥有庞大的开发者社区,遇到问题时可快速获得帮助,加速了问题解决的速度
二、构建Linux空路由的步骤 构建Linux空路由的过程大致可以分为以下几个步骤: 1.硬件准备:选择一台性能适中的计算机或专用路由器硬件作为载体,确保有足够的CPU、内存和存储空间以支持路由功能
2.安装Linux操作系统:根据个人偏好和硬件兼容性,选择合适的Linux发行版(如Ubuntu、Debian、OpenWrt等),并进行系统安装
OpenWrt特别适用于嵌入式设备,因其专为小型设备设计,轻量级且功能丰富
3.配置网络接口:根据网络环境,配置有线和无线网络接口,确保路由器能够正确连接内外网络
这通常涉及设置静态IP、动态DNS解析等
4.安装并配置路由服务:安装如iptables、`firewalld`等防火墙软件,配置NAT(网络地址转换)和DHCP(动态主机配置协议)服务,确保网络流量正确转发和分配IP地址
5.优化与测试:根据实际需求,调整系统参数,如TCP/IP参数调优、内存管理等,以提高路由性能
随后进行网络连通性测试,确保一切设置正确无误
三、Linux空路由的应用场景 Linux空路由因其灵活性和强大的功能,适用于多种应用场景: 1.家庭网络:为家庭用户提供安全、稳定的网络连接,支持多设备同时在线,实现智能家居设备的无缝接入
2.小型企业网络:为小型企业提供经济实惠的网络解决方案,支持VLAN(虚拟局域网)划分,提高网络管理的灵活性和安全性
3.教育机构:在教育网络中,Linux空路由可以实现复杂的网络策略,如内容过滤、访问控制等,保障教育资源的有效利用
4.ISP(互联网服务提供商):对于ISP而言,Linux空路由能够支持大规模网络部署,提供高性能的流量转发和精细的流量管理
5.物联网(IoT)网关:在物联网场景中,Linux空路由作为连接物理世界与数字世界的桥梁,能够处理大量设备的数据传输,实现设备间的有效通信
四、Linux空路由的安全策略 安全是构建任何网络架构时不可忽视的一环
Linux空路由通过以下策略,可以有效提升网络的安全性: 1.防火墙配置:利用iptables或`
Linux空路由:打造高效网络中枢
浙大Linux系统高效上网指南
Linux Nginx高效配置指南
Xshell实战:轻松实现向虚拟机上传文件的技巧指南
云电脑高效截图软件,一键捕获精彩瞬间
Linux系统下快速停止网卡操作指南
Linux系统JDK环境配置指南
浙大Linux系统高效上网指南
Linux Nginx高效配置指南
Linux系统下快速停止网卡操作指南
Linux系统JDK环境配置指南
连接Linux的MO技巧大揭秘
Linux Beeline连接数据库实用指南
Kali Linux在HTC设备上的深度应用探索与教程
Linux系统轻松进入SSH指南
如何判断Linux系统是否为64位
Linux内存碎片:优化与管理策略
Linux系统下轻松建立服务器间互信指南
Linux无yum?解决方案来袭!